19.0 DATA SIGNAL MODULATOR

The Data Signal Modulator (DSM) allows the user to
mix a digital data stream (the “modulator signal”) with a
carrier signal to produce a modulated output. Both the
carrier and the modulator signals are supplied to the
DSM module, either internally from the output of a
peripheral, or externally through an input pin.
The modulated output signal is generated by perform-
ing a logical AND operation of both the carrier and
modulator signals and then it is provided to the MDOUT
pin. Using this method, the DSM can generate the
following types of key modulation schemes:
• Frequency Shift Keying (FSK)
• Phase Shift Keying (PSK)
• On-Off Keying (OOK)
